Output 8ca54f3264a130eac73cce014befcc3cfebcdb44402efeeab478fd08b4e2916b:0

value
1031796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e53e2b63e6bbe38a67392bae6c39134115792481 OP_EQUALVERIFY OP_CHECKSIG
address
1Mu8DYPrUZKew5DVpoTJqKzjFWcQxLrfqZ
transaction
8ca54f3264a130eac73cce014befcc3cfebcdb44402efeeab478fd08b4e2916b
confirmations
615416
spent
true